We base our costs on the Law Society guidelines of 0.75% of a property and 1.5% of any other assets. We keep time records so the exact cost will depend on the individual circumstances of the matter. In accordance with these guidelines, the cost of the majority of Estates managed falls between 1% and 3% of the gross estate. Our fees are subject to VAT at 20%.

Sometimes unexpected issues may arise during the administration of the Estate and these may increase our costs. For example, we may be required to document any variations in the terms of the Will or there may be claim made against the Estate. Should such an event occur then we will confirm the increased cost with you before proceeding with any related work.

In addition to our costs, there are a number of disbursements to pay. Disbursements are costs related to your matter that are payable to third parties. How Long Will it Take?

It is very difficult to predict exactly how long the administration of an Estate will take as each Estate differs in complexity. As previously stated unexpected issues may arise during the administration that may result in delays.

We always aim to complete the administration of the Estate as soon as possible and in particular within the Executors year, which is one year from the date of death. We will give you a time estimate during our first meeting based on the information you provide to us and will keep you updated throughout the process.
